博客 高校轻量化数据中台架构与微服务实现

高校轻量化数据中台架构与微服务实现

   数栈君   发表于 2026-03-28 12:13  22  0

高校轻量化数据中台架构与微服务实现

在高等教育数字化转型加速的背景下,高校信息化建设正从“系统孤立”向“数据协同”演进。传统教务、人事、科研、后勤等系统各自为政,数据孤岛严重,决策依赖人工汇总,响应滞后。构建一套轻量化、可扩展、低维护成本的数据中台,已成为高校提升治理效能的核心路径。本文将系统解析“高校轻量化数据中台”的架构设计逻辑与微服务实现方法,帮助教育信息化管理者快速落地实用方案。


一、什么是高校轻量化数据中台?

高校轻量化数据中台不是传统企业级中台的复刻,而是针对高校业务特点(数据量适中、系统异构性强、预算有限、运维能力有限)量身定制的轻量级数据整合与服务引擎。其核心目标是:

  • 打通异构系统:整合教务系统(如正方、超星)、科研管理系统、一卡通、图书馆、宿舍管理、财务系统等;
  • 统一数据标准:建立学籍、教师、课程、项目等核心实体的标准化编码与元数据规范;
  • 提供即用服务:通过API或可视化组件,向院系、管理部门提供实时数据查询、报表生成、预警分析能力;
  • 降低运维负担:采用容器化部署、自动化调度、无代码配置,减少对专业DBA的依赖。

与大型企业中台不同,高校中台无需支撑亿级并发,但需具备高灵活性与强适应性。轻量化 ≠ 简陋,而是以最小必要组件实现最大价值。


二、轻量化架构设计:四层模型

一个典型的高校轻量化数据中台采用“四层解耦”架构,每层独立演进,降低耦合风险:

1. 数据接入层:多源异构采集

高校系统多为老旧C/S架构或私有协议,直接对接数据库成本高。推荐采用:

  • ETL工具轻量化部署:使用Apache NiFi或DataX,通过JDBC/ODBC连接各业务库,无需修改源系统;
  • API网关代理:对已提供RESTful接口的系统(如智慧校园平台),通过API网关统一认证与限流;
  • 定时增量同步:每日凌晨执行增量抽取,避免影响白天业务系统性能;
  • 数据脱敏机制:自动对身份证号、手机号、成绩等敏感字段进行掩码或哈希处理,符合《个人信息保护法》要求。

📌 实践建议:优先接入5个核心系统(教务、人事、科研、一卡通、资产),形成“最小可行数据集”。

2. 数据存储层:混合存储策略

高校数据结构多样,不宜“一刀切”使用大数据平台。

数据类型存储方案说明
结构化数据(学生信息、课程表)PostgreSQL / MySQL支持事务,易维护,适合高频查询
半结构化数据(日志、表单)MongoDB灵活Schema,适应表单字段变动
时序数据(门禁打卡、能耗)InfluxDB高效存储时间序列,支持聚合分析
缓存数据(热门报表)Redis减少数据库压力,提升响应速度

✅ 推荐使用Docker Compose统一部署,避免Kubernetes等重型编排,降低运维门槛。

3. 数据服务层:微服务化API网关

这是轻量化中台的核心价值输出层。采用Spring Boot + Spring Cloud Alibaba构建微服务集群,每个服务职责单一:

  • student-service:提供学生基本信息、选课状态、绩点查询;
  • research-service:聚合科研项目、论文、专利数据;
  • energy-service:分析楼宇用电趋势,支持节能预警;
  • report-service:按需生成Excel/PDF报表,支持自定义模板;

所有服务通过Nacos注册发现,由Gateway统一鉴权(JWT)、限流(Sentinel)、日志追踪(SkyWalking)。服务间通信采用HTTP/REST,避免复杂RPC协议,便于前端调用。

🔧 微服务优势:某模块升级不影响整体;新院系接入只需新增一个服务,无需重构。

4. 应用呈现层:低代码可视化

面向非技术用户(如教务处、院长办公室),提供拖拽式仪表盘预置模板

  • 支持拖拽图表(柱状图、热力图、折线图);
  • 可绑定数据服务API,实时刷新;
  • 支持权限分级:院系只能看本院数据,校领导可看全校视图;
  • 导出功能:一键生成PDF报告,用于向上级汇报。

⚠️ 注意:避免使用商业BI工具,优先选择开源方案如Superset或自研前端组件,控制成本。


三、关键技术实现:微服务如何支撑轻量化?

1. 容器化部署:Docker + Docker Compose

将每个微服务打包为独立镜像,通过docker-compose.yml一键启动:

version: '3.8'services:  postgres:    image: postgres:14    ports:      - "5432:5432"  redis:    image: redis:7-alpine    ports:      - "6379:6379"  student-service:    build: ./student-service    ports:      - "8081:8080"    depends_on:      - postgres  gateway:    build: ./gateway    ports:      - "8080:8080"    depends_on:      - student-service      - research-service

✅ 优势:部署时间从数小时缩短至10分钟,支持快速回滚。

2. 配置中心:Nacos统一管理

所有服务的数据库连接、API密钥、阈值参数统一存储于Nacos,修改后自动推送,无需重启服务。

3. 数据质量监控:自动校验规则

在数据接入后,自动执行:

  • 唯一性校验(学号重复);
  • 范围校验(成绩不能>100);
  • 完整性校验(必填字段是否为空);
  • 异常数据自动告警至管理员邮箱。

📊 每日生成《数据质量日报》,提升数据可信度。

4. 权限控制:RBAC + 数据权限

  • 用户角色:管理员、院系管理员、教师、学生;
  • 数据权限:基于组织架构(学院→专业→班级)动态过滤;
  • 示例:计算机学院院长只能查看本院学生数据,无法访问医学院数据。

四、典型应用场景落地

场景实现方式效果
招生分析整合历年报考数据、生源地、分数段,生成热力图提前预测生源结构,优化专业设置
教学预警分析挂科率、出勤率、作业提交率,自动标记高风险学生辅导员可提前介入,提升学业完成率
科研绩效评估自动聚合论文、项目、专利、经费数据,生成教师科研画像取代人工填报,提升公平性
能耗管理对接智能电表,分析各楼宇用电峰谷,提出节能建议年节省电费15%以上
毕业去向追踪关联就业系统与校友平台,生成毕业生就业流向报告为专业调整提供数据支撑

五、为什么选择轻量化?避免三大误区

误区正解
❌ “必须上大数据平台”高校数据量通常在百万级以内,Hadoop/Spark过度设计
❌ “要完全替换旧系统”轻量化中台是“粘合剂”,不取代原有系统,降低风险
❌ “必须招聘数据科学家”通过低代码工具+标准化模板,普通IT人员即可运维

轻量化不是妥协,而是精准适配。高校的数字化不是为了炫技,而是解决实际问题。


六、实施路线图:6步快速启动

  1. 成立专项小组:信息化中心牵头,教务、科研、后勤各派1人;
  2. 梳理核心数据域:确定5个关键实体(学生、教师、课程、项目、资产);
  3. 选择技术栈:PostgreSQL + Spring Boot + Nacos + Docker + Superset;
  4. 接入首批系统:教务+人事+一卡通,完成3周内上线;
  5. 开发3个典型应用:学生预警、科研画像、能耗分析;
  6. 推广培训:面向院系开展“数据看板使用工作坊”。

🚀 推荐从“一个院系试点”开始,成功后横向复制,降低变革阻力。


七、持续优化:从“能用”到“好用”

  • 每季度更新数据标准,适配新业务(如国际学生管理);
  • 引入AI辅助:基于历史数据预测选课高峰、实验室预约冲突;
  • 开放API给校内开发者:鼓励二次开发,形成生态;
  • 建立数据治理委员会:定期评审数据质量与使用合规性。

八、结语:轻量化不是终点,而是起点

高校轻量化数据中台不是一次性的项目,而是一套可持续演进的数据治理机制。它让数据从“沉睡的表格”变为“流动的资产”,让管理者从“凭经验决策”转向“靠数据说话”。

当前,已有超过120所高校通过轻量化路径实现数据驱动治理,平均提升管理效率40%以上。技术不是障碍,关键是选对方法、聚焦价值、小步快跑

如果您正在规划高校数字化升级,不妨从轻量化数据中台开始。申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s

无需重金投入,无需漫长周期。一个轻量、敏捷、可扩展的数据中台,正在成为新时代高校的核心基础设施。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料